 The second part of the novel Tony recounts the next forty
years of his life until his sixties. Now Tony starts the narration of
the second part of the novel.
 second part of the novel is twice as long as the first part.
 The second part of the novel begins with the arrival of a lawyer’s
letter that informs Tony that Veronica’s mother has left him five
hundred pounds and two documents.
 Tony to re-established contact with Veronica and after a number of
meetings with her, to re-evaluate the story he has narrated in the first
part.
 Tony tries to remember his school days, college days and his breakup
with Veronica as he himself choose peaceful life
